For technology providers, establishing clear ownership rights in AI-generated content is critical. As AI systems become more advanced, the line between human-created and AI-generated work blurs, complicating traditional ownership models. Providers must outline whether the rights to AI output reside with them or their users, significantly affecting licensing agreements.
Different licensing models present unique challenges and opportunities. Fixed licensing agreements may offer stability but can limit flexibility. On the other hand, subscription-based models may encourage innovation, allowing access to continual updates and improvements.
Customers engaging with AI technology must also be aware of their rights concerning AI ownership. Clear and transparent agreements help avoid potential disputes over the use and modification of AI-generated content. Customers should seek to negotiate terms that protect their interests while allowing for the creative use of AI technologies.
